>Now that I have the driver instances running, I'm not sure howto actually 
>perform CvP.  Do you use a debugfs interface or something else?  Do you 
>use the sof or an rbf file?

I used the debugfs interface for first testing, now I'm using custom
fpga config interface driver, but it depends on many other drivers
and won't work without additional special hardware.

I use an rbf file. The v2 patch [1] used a module parameter to specify
firmware file name for a given PCIe device, but it is bypassing the
framework and is not acceptable for mainline.
